Anton Yelchin In Star Trek & Tragic Death Explained

Beginning with J.J. Abrams' Star Trek (2009), Anton Yelchin played Ensign Pavel Chekov in three Star Trek films before his tragic and untimely death in 2016. Following the James T. Kirk (Chris Pine) and Spock (Zachary Quinto) of the alternate Kelvin timeline, J.J. Abrams' Star Trek films re-energized the Star Trek movie franchise, introducing countless new fans to the series. Star Trek: Enterprise ended with a whimper four years before and there had not been a Star Trek feature film since the lackluster Star Trek: Nemesis in 2002.
Star Trek (2009) introduced updated versions of the classic characters from Star Trek: The Original Series, including the young Russian Starfleet officer, Pavel Chekov. Originally played by Walter Koenig, Chekov was the youngest of the USS Enterprise bridge crew and was often defined by his love for his Russian heritage.
